10” living room cabinet by dadomann in homelab

[–]siegesmith 4 points5 points  (0 children)

And further, make sure that there are some ventilation holes in the shelf itself. With the door closed, you would essentially have two separate compartments. Alternatively, you could have fans on either side of the cabinet blowing across the two compartments. That might help with noise by allowing the fans to spin at lower RPM. There are companies that make specific kits for this application. I used this site for the air flow calculations. https://acinfinity.com/pages/hvac-setup/cabinet-cooling-and-ventilation.html
